THERMOCOUPLE TRANSMITTER
Functions & Features
• The DC input from the thermocouple sensor is amplified, compensated the cold junction, linearized and provided as an isolated DC
• Mutual isolation (input to output)
• Cold junction compensation, Linearization, and upscale/downscale burnout
• Space-saving, easyto-maintain, multi-channel installation base
• Isolates between analog output channels of a PLC

[1] INPUT THERMOCOUPLE
2
: K (CA) (Usable range -270 to +1370°C, -454 to +2498°F)
3
: E (CRC) (Usable range -270 to +1000°C, -454 to +1832°F)
4
: J (IC) (Usable range -210 to +1200°C, -346 to +2192°F)
5
: T (CC) (Usable range -270 to +400°C, -454 to +752°F)
6
: B (RH) (Usable range 0 to 1820°C, 32 to 3308°F)
7
: R (Usable range -50 to +1760°C, -58 to +3200°F)
8
: S (Usable range -50 to +1760°C, -58 to +3200°F)
N
: N (Usable range -270 to +1300°C, -454 to +2372°F)
